I've got a few Case XX, my favorite was always the swing guards, like the Cheetah. People that collect case knives are probably the only thing keeping them in buisness, not to many people buy Case to use anymore. Not with the advent of tactical folders anyway. It's a shame, they make great pocket knives. The bullet knives are great to collect. If he has one of the original ones from 1982 it's worth $700, not bad for a $40 when new knife.
